About Lucky Rock, Quebec

Lucky Rock is a locality in Lac-Duparquet; Abitibi-Ouest, Quebec,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Lucky Rock is located at 48.4403°N, 79.3165°W.

Lucky Rock stands as a quiet sentinel of stone, anchored firmly within the rugged expanse near the rising slope of Traverse Hill. It lies 31.6 km north-west of Rouyn-Noranda, QC (from Rouyn-Noranda, QC: bearing 316°T), and is situated 9.7 km south-west of Duparquet.
